Chapter 216 Murderer

“Dad! Dad, are you alright?” Yvette shook Russell violently, but the man remained still as though he was dead.

Shocked, she staggered backward. It took her a while before she mustered up her courage to check Russell’s breath.

Two seconds later, Yvette’s face drained of color as she murmured, “Dad’s dead.”

“What? Mr. Actonward is dead?”

“How did that happen? Did someone call for the ambulance?”

The scene became chaotic.

Instantly, Shandie was pinned to the ground.

“Murderer! You murdered Mr. Actonward!”

“Tie her up and send her to jail!”

Yvette couldn’t be bothered to reprimand “Arielle” as she was at a loss.

Her plan was to pull a prank on Arielle and accuse the latter of being rude. She didn’t expect her father would end up dead.

This isn’t part of my plan! Why did this happen?

The Actonward family was a prominent family, but she was the only daughter of her parents. Her mother had passed away due to illness the year before, so if her father ended up dead, the Actonward family would lose its pillar of support.

Besides, the Baker family had just called off her engagement. Hence, she had nowhere else to go.

Without her father’s support, her downfall would arrive soon.

Dejection and fury swamped her instantly.

Suddenly, Yvette felt like choking Arielle to death.

Yes! I shall kill Arielle as she killed my father! I need to take revenge!

At that moment, Yvette had lost her mind.

Her rationality had deserted her. Right now, she wanted to kill Arielle without caring that she might need to serve a sentence for taking someone’s life.

As Yvette leaped to her feet to seek revenge, a clear voice rang out amidst the chaos. “Everyone, please make way. I know some first aid knowledge. The ambulance takes some time to get here, and time is precious. Let me take a look.”

Yvette was shocked to hear that voice.

Isn’t that Arielle? How dare she offer to save my dad? She was the one who killed Dad!

Yvette whipped her head around to glare at Arielle.

When she saw that Arielle was clad in a white evening gown instead of the black dress that she prepared ahead, she was dumbstruck.

Shouldn’t Arielle be wearing the black evening gown which I prepared for her? Why is she wearing a white one?

Wait. If Arielle is wearing white, who was the one in that black dress?

Yvette turned to stare at the girl clad in black, who was now surrounded by the crowd. The girl was cornered and tied up, but her face was still visible.

Wait… Is that Shandie Southall? How could it be? I delivered the dress to Arielle!

So Arielle wasn’t the one who killed Dad. It was… Shandie?

No! That’s impossible! How could that be?

Yvette was still speechless as Arielle made her way over.

Arielle had arrived when Shandie just entered the hall, so she saw everything that happened.

Though she was snickering inwardly, it was still a narrow escape for her.

After all, if she hadn’t thought of investigating Yvette’s family history, she would be accused as the murderer now.

And it wouldn’t be easy to remove the blame pinned on her.
